Viruses have several unique features that distinguish them from living organisms. They are acellular, meaning they lack cellular structures and cannot reproduce independently; they require a host cell to replicate. Viruses consist of genetic material (either DNA or RNA) enclosed in a protein coat called a capsid, and some have an additional lipid envelope. Their ability to evolve rapidly and adapt to host defenses is another notable characteristic, contributing to their diversity and complexity.
